Fire at Dongducheon Temple... One Monk in His 70s Dies

Extinguished after about seven hours

A fire broke out at a temple in Dongducheon-si, Gyeonggi Province, resulting in the death of a monk in his 70s.



According to the Gyeonggi Northern Fire and Disaster Headquarters on the 11th, the fire that started around 8:15 a.m. the previous day at a temple in Saengyeon-dong, Dongducheon-si, was completely extinguished after about seven hours.


The fire claimed the life of a monk in his 70s, identified as Mr. A. It is preliminarily believed that Mr. A was in the attic of the temple and was unable to evacuate in time. Three residents living in a house behind the building evacuated urgently.

The fire completely destroyed one temple building measuring 51.4 square meters, and furnishings and home appliances were lost, with the fire department estimating property damage at 48 million KRW.


Upon receiving the report, the fire authorities dispatched 22 pieces of equipment and 59 personnel to the scene to carry out firefighting and rescue operations.


The police and fire authorities are investigating the exact cause, believing the fire started due to negligence in handling a wood-fired boiler.
